
Jim Haynie
Born February 6, 1940 · Falls Church, Virginia, USA
Jim Haynie was born on February 6, 1940 in Falls Church, Virginia, USA. He was an actor, known for The Bridges of Madison County (1995), Country (1984) and The Right Stuff (1983). He was previously married to Maggie Causey and Janice A McKelheer. He died on April 3, 2021 in Langley, Washington, USA.
